All Nutrition Store locator South America

All Nutrition store locator South America displays complete list and huge database of All Nutrition stores, factory stores, shops and boutiques in South America. All Nutrition information: map of South America, shopping hours, contact information.

All Nutrition stores located in South America: 3
Largest shopping mall with All Nutrition store in South America: Mall Plaza Oeste 

Search all All Nutrition stores located in South America

Specify All Nutrition store location:

Go to the city All Nutrition locator